UPDATE: CHRISTOPHER TODD SMITH TRIAL DELAYED - Vandal Sentenced To State Penitentiary

(08/14/2009)
A trial scheduled this week over drug charges against Christopher Todd Smith was continued by Judge David W. Nibert, who first indicated he did not want to continue the case, saying the case has been on the court docket for five terms of court.

Smith's attorney Tom Whitter presented motions for a continuance, in addition to a number of motions from quashing the indictment to a protective order to a change of venue.

A pre-trail hearing for the motions has been set in Spencer on September 22 at 10 a.m., with a new trial to be scheduled at a later date.

Smith was charged in 2007 by Grantsville Police Chief Charles Stephens.

The court sentenced Jimmy Jack Vandal to one-to-ten years in the state penitentiary for property crimes committed in Calhoun and Wirt.

The court determined Kenneth Rush incompetent to stand trial, in relation to charges of sex offenses lodged against him, and he was sent to William Sharpe Hospital in Weston.

Randy Shrader of Creston has plead guilty to charges related to the manufacturing of marijuana, sentenced to be issued.
